Установка LAMP на Ubuntu с помощью FileZilla – Подробная инструкция


LAMP (Linux, Apache, MySQL, PHP) — это одна из самых популярных конфигураций сервера, используемых в веб-разработке. Установка и настройка LAMP на операционной системе Ubuntu предоставляет возможность создавать и развертывать веб-приложения с минимальными усилиями.

FileZilla является одним из самых популярных FTP-клиентов, который позволяет легко управлять файлами на удаленном сервере. С его помощью можно быстро и удобно загрузить необходимые файлы и настроить доступ к серверу.

В этой подробной инструкции будет рассмотрено, как установить LAMP на Ubuntu с использованием FileZilla. Вы получите все необходимые шаги для установки и настройки компонентов LAMP (Apache, MySQL и PHP), а также научитесь использовать FileZilla для подключения к серверу и управления файлами.

Подготовка к установке

Перед установкой LAMP на Ubuntu с помощью FileZilla необходимо выполнить несколько предварительных действий.

1. Убедитесь, что у вас установлена последняя версия Ubuntu и все доступные обновления.

2. Установите FileZilla, если его еще нет на вашем компьютере. FileZilla позволит вам установить соединение с удаленным сервером, чтобы загружать файлы и настраивать настройки.

3. Установите все необходимые зависимости для LAMP. Обычно это включает в себя Apache, MySQL и PHP. Зависимости можно установить с помощью команды apt-get install.

4. Создайте новую директорию на вашем сервере, в которую будут загружаться файлы во время установки LAMP.

5. Откройте FileZilla и введите IP-адрес вашего сервера, имя пользователя и пароль, чтобы установить подключение к серверу.

Теперь вы готовы к установке LAMP на Ubuntu с помощью FileZilla и можете переходить к следующему этапу.

Установка и настройка Ubuntu

Установка операционной системы Ubuntu может показаться сложной задачей, особенно для новичков. Однако, следуя подробным инструкциям, вы сможете легко и быстро установить Ubuntu на ваш компьютер.

Вот пошаговая инструкция для установки и настройки Ubuntu:

Шаг 1:Загрузите установочный образ Ubuntu с официального сайта ubuntu.com
Шаг 2:Запишите загруженный образ на USB-флешку с помощью специального программного обеспечения.
Шаг 3:Подключите USB-флешку к компьютеру и перезагрузите его.
Шаг 4:Выберите режим установки Ubuntu и следуйте инструкциям на экране.
Шаг 5:Настройте язык, часовой пояс, имя пользователя и пароль.
Шаг 6:Установите дополнительное программное обеспечение (по желанию).
Шаг 7:Перезагрузите компьютер и начните пользоваться Ubuntu!

После установки Ubuntu вы можете настроить систему под свои потребности, загрузив дополнительное программное обеспечение, установив обновления и настроив интерфейс.

Установка и настройка Ubuntu предоставляют вам разнообразные возможности для работы и развлечений. Наслаждайтесь своим новым операционным окружением!

Установка и настройка Apache

Шаг 1: Обновление системы

Перед установкой Apache рекомендуется обновить систему. Откройте терминал и выполните следующую команду:

sudo apt update

Шаг 2: Установка Apache

Установите Apache, введя следующую команду:

sudo apt install apache2

Во время установки вам может быть предложено ввести пароль для пользователя root. Введите пароль и подтвердите его.

Шаг 3: Проверка установки

После установки Apache вы можете проверить его работу, открыв веб-браузер и введя в адресной строке следующий URL: http://localhost. Если вы увидите страницу приветствия Apache, значит, установка прошла успешно.

Шаг 4: Настройка виртуального хоста

Чтобы настроить виртуальный хост для вашего проекта, создайте новый конфигурационный файл в директории /etc/apache2/sites-available/. Например, если вы хотите настроить виртуальный хост для домена example.com, выполните следующую команду:

sudo nano /etc/apache2/sites-available/example.com.conf

В этом файле определите настройки виртуального хоста, такие как директория корневого каталога, логи и настройки доступа. После завершения настройки сохраните файл и закройте текстовый редактор.

Затем активируйте виртуальный хост, выполнив следующую команду:

sudo a2ensite example.com.conf

Шаг 5: Перезапуск Apache

Для применения изменений перезапустите Apache, выполнив следующую команду:

sudo systemctl restart apache2

Теперь ваш веб-сервер Apache настроен и готов к использованию! Вы можете размещать файлы вашего проекта в директории корневого каталога виртуального хоста и они будут доступны по указанному вами доменному имени.

Установка и настройка MySQL

Шаг 1: Откройте терминал на вашей Ubuntu системе.

Шаг 2: Введите следующую команду, чтобы установить MySQL:

sudo apt-get install mysql-server

Шаг 3: Во время установки система попросит вас ввести пароль для нового пользователя root.

Шаг 4: После установки введите следующую команду, чтобы запустить MySQL:

sudo service mysql start

Шаг 5: Чтобы проверить, работает ли MySQL, выполните следующую команду:

sudo service mysql status

После выполнения этих шагов вы успешно установите и настроите MySQL на вашей Ubuntu системе.

Установка и настройка PHP

1. Перед установкой PHP убедитесь, что у вас установлен и настроен Apache сервер. Если его нет, выполните следующую команду:

sudo apt-get install apache2

2. Теперь установим PHP и необходимые пакеты:

sudo apt-get install php libapache2-mod-php php-mysql

3. После установки перезапустите Apache сервер, чтобы изменения вступили в силу:

sudo service apache2 restart

4. Для проверки правильной установки PHP, создайте файл с расширением .php в директории /var/www/html:

sudo nano /var/www/html/info.php

5. Внутри файла добавьте следующий код:

<?php phpinfo(); ?>

6. Сохраните файл и закройте редактор.

7. Теперь вы можете открыть веб-браузер и перейти по ссылке http://YourServerIP/info.php. Если вы увидите информацию о PHP, значит, он установлен и настроен правильно.

Теперь вы готовы использовать PHP на своем сервере LAMP на Ubuntu.

Установка и настройка FileZilla

1. Установка FileZilla:

1.1. Откройте терминал и выполните следующую команду для установки FileZilla:

sudo apt install filezilla

2. Запуск FileZilla:

2.1. После успешной установки можно найти FileZilla в меню приложений или запустить его из терминала командой:

filezilla

3. Настройка подключения:

3.1. После запуска FileZilla откроется окно «Управление учетными записями». Нажмите на кнопку «Добавить новый сайт».

3.2. Введите имя хоста (IP-адрес или доменное имя сервера), номер порта (обычно 21 для FTP, 22 для SFTP) и протокол (FTP, SFTP или FTPS).

3.3. Выберите тип входа (обычно «Нормальный») и введите учетные данные (имя пользователя и пароль) для доступа к серверу.

3.4. Щелкните на кнопку «Подключиться» для установки соединения с сервером.

4. Передача файлов:

4.1. После успешного подключения к серверу вы увидите два панеля — локальный файловый менеджер (на вашем компьютере) и удаленный файловый менеджер (на сервере).

4.2. Чтобы загрузить файл на сервер, просто перетащите его из локального менеджера в удаленный менеджер.

4.3. Чтобы загрузить файл с сервера на компьютер, просто перетащите его из удаленного менеджера в локальный менеджер.

Теперь вы знаете, как установить и настроить FileZilla на Ubuntu, а также как использовать его для передачи файлов между компьютером и сервером. Удачной работы!

Подключение к серверу через FileZilla

Для подключения к серверу через FileZilla вам понадобятся следующие данные:

1. IP-адрес сервера

2. Порт

3. Имя пользователя

4. Пароль

5. Протокол передачи данных (FTP, SFTP или FTPS)

После запуска FileZilla вам нужно будет ввести все необходимые данные и нажать кнопку «Подключиться».

Если данные введены правильно, FileZilla установит соединение с сервером и вы сможете приступить к работе.

Важно помнить, что для безопасного подключения рекомендуется использовать протокол SFTP или FTPS.

Теперь вы готовы приступить к установке LAMP на вашем сервере Ubuntu с помощью FileZilla.

Загрузка файлов на сервер через FileZilla

Для начала работы с FileZilla вам необходимо установить его на ваш компьютер. Вы можете скачать его с официального сайта и следовать инструкциям по установке.

После успешной установки откройте FileZilla и введите данные вашего FTP-сервера. Введите хост, логин и пароль, который были предоставлены вашим хостинг-провайдером.

После успешного подключения к серверу вы увидите две панели — левая панель представляет файлы на вашем локальном компьютере, а правая панель представляет файлы на сервере.

Для загрузки файлов на сервер вы можете просто перетащить их из левой панели в правую панель. Вы также можете использовать встроенное меню «Передача» и выбрать опцию «Загрузить файлы».

Во время загрузки файлов вы увидите прогресс-бар, который отображает скорость загрузки и оставшееся время. После завершения загрузки файлы будут доступны на вашем сервере.

Не забывайте следить за правами доступа к вашим загруженным файлам. Вы можете изменить права доступа, щелкнув правой кнопкой мыши на файле и выбрав опцию «Изменить права доступа».

Теперь, когда вы знаете, как загружать файлы на сервер через FileZilla, вы можете управлять вашими файлами на сервере удобным и эффективным способом.

Проверка работы установленной LAMP

После успешной установки LAMP на ваш сервер Ubuntu, вам необходимо проверить, что все компоненты стека LAMP работают корректно.

1. Apache:

Для проверки работы Apache введите в веб-браузере адрес вашего сервера (например, http://ваш_сервер/) и нажмите Enter. Если в браузере отображается страница приветствия Apache, это означает, что сервер успешно установлен и работает.

2. MySQL:

Чтобы убедиться, что MySQL работает, откройте терминал и введите команду:

mysql -u root -p

Программа запросит ввести пароль для пользователя root. Если введенный пароль совпадает с паролем пользователя root в MySQL, вы увидите интерактивный командный интерфейс MySQL.

3. PHP:

Для проверки работы PHP создайте простой скрипт, назовите его info.php, и поместите его в директорию /var/www/html/. Содержимое файла info.php:

<?php phpinfo(); ?>

Затем откройте веб-браузер и введите в адресной строке адрес веб-сайта info.php (например, http://ваш_сервер/info.php). Если в браузере отображается информация о версии PHP и его настройках, значит PHP работает корректно на вашем сервере.

Поздравляю! Вы успешно установили LAMP и проверили его функциональность.

Добавить комментарий

Вам также может понравиться